Template Of War
How can I fight others
if my war
is inside?
If my scars
mar my judgment?
How can I tell them to kill me
if I have
no mouth?
I am a template of war.
Bang, bang, bang
Codes my head against the surface
They can't fathom the rhythm.
I am a template of war.
Eyes, blind and shut
Facilitated breathing
I can't hear their last requests
Always conscious, sober
Begging to sleep
Undeciphered dreams overcome
And I can't even die.
I am a template of war.
